Rustremoving grades of steel material are divided into four grades, they are: ⑴ St 2 thorough hand and power tool rustremoving. No visible grease and dirt or no adherend of loosen oxide skin, rust, paint skin ,and etc. on surface of steel material. ⑵ St 3 extreme thorough hand and power tool rustremoving No visible grease and dirt or no adherend of loosen oxide skin, rust, paint skin ,and etc. on surface of steel kind of rust removing should be done more thoroughly than St 2, surface of ground exposure part ought to have metal brightness. ⑶ Sa 2 thorough injection or slinging rust removing No visible grease and dirt on surface of steel material, adherend of oxide skin, rust and paint skin ,and etc. have been basically removed, the residue could be firmly adherent. ⑷ Sa extreme thorough injection or slinging rustremoving No visible grease and dirt, adherend of oxide skin, rust and paint skin and etc. on surface of steel — 9 — material, any residual trace should only be slight stain having spotted or striated state. Anticorrosion coating using life of onground equipment and piping should be adapted to the turn round of plant, less than two yeas are unsuitable.
